I am aware of a few people who have been hit by ransomware last year; one I know personally. He opened an attachment in a bogus Australia Post email purporting to be advice of a parcel for collection and it proceeded to encrypt every file on his hard drive and then demanded US$650 in bitcoins to reverse the process.
Massively disruptive to his business. Of course he never backed up his PC.
Beware of every email attachment. This can't be said often enough.

I've seen the Post ones. There's another that comes from the Australian Federal Police that demands payment for a speeding fine. Most people don't know that the AFP doesn't issue speeding fines outside the ACT so plenty would click the link out of curiosity.
One came for me recently from the Australian Business Register asking me to renew a business name I once had. It was a close call, as the e-mail looked quite professional, came to the address that fair-dinkum ABR e-mails come to regarding my dealings with them and the business name was one I did actually own for a long time. Despite all that, the e-mail was indeed a fraud. The problem for the sender was that I don't own that many business and trading names that would cause me to lose track of the wheres and what fors.

There's good news on that front. The server has two discs, so if one fails it can be changed without shutting the server down and then the remaining disc writes an image to the new disc, restoring the first layer of redundancy. Secondly, there's a weekly backup with a grandfathering routine which means many copies of the backup going back six months and then yearly a DVD is made of the whole site.
We had a server die here about five or six years ago - not a byte of data lost - thank Christ.
The new server is a step closer. In the meantime here's a code buster for commonly experienced errors:-
403 - permission to access the page is refused.
404 - the page is missing.
500 - server cannot complete loading of the page. (hundreds of possible reasons and some hard to find)
503 - web service is off. Some members have seen this in the last few days and it is just me rebooting the service to help keep things up as much as possible until the new server comes online.
